Limiting distributions in queueing networks with unreliable elements
Authors:G. Sh. Tsitsiashvili  M. A. Osipova
Affiliation:(1) Institute of Applied Mathematics, Far East Branch of the RAS, Vladivostok, Russia
Abstract:We consider multichannel systems and open queueing networks with unreliable elements: nodes, paths between nodes, and channels at nodes. Computation of limiting distributions in a product form for these models is based on choosing recovery schemes for unreliable elements (independent recovery, recovery at a single site, recovering network scheme), routing algorithms, and service disciplines. Thus, by introducing a certain control, we constructively relate queueing theory with reliability theory. Results of the paper can be transferred to closed networks almost without changes.
